Instead of the notch, Apple chose the Dynamic Island to sit at the top of theiPhone 14 Proand iPhone 14 Pro Max. This little “pill” comes to life according to the different actions of iOS 16, and makes the double punch that is actually hiding in the background more comfortable. And the least we can say is that the design is particularly successful: even during screenshots,this interface element is displayed just when it is needed.
We were therefore logically entitled to ask ourselves what is happening in modeEasy access. For novices, know that this is the option that allows you toreach the top of your iPhone screen if it is too far from your thumb. The software is then reduced to a sufficient size, but until now we did not know how the Dynamic Island would support such a solution. It is now done.
Like clockwork
As we can see in the following images, with iOS 16 the Dynamic Island therefore remains installed at the top of the screen, even when Easy Access mode is activated and the interface is moved down. THErest of the display is then complete, without the space between the time and the battery in the status bar being darkened.

But that was without counting on the first beta version of iOS 16.1, just released. Indeed, with this one the behavior of the Dynamic Island is even different. Here,I go down to pillsas well with the rest of the interface, including all the information displayed between the TrueDepth sensor and the FaceTime camera. However, a black space installed in the original location of the island remains present.
